WOW first, AHA after
WOW stops the scroll
AHA makes the idea click
The plugin aims for both
WOW is the visual pull: a strong concept, a clear focal point, confident color, smart composition, and motion with a job
AHA is the payoff: the reader sees a relationship, comparison, transformation, state change, interface flow, or reveal that makes the idea easier to understand
If the effect looks good but adds no meaning, it is decoration

OpenAI autopilot
linkedin-infographic-autopilot begins by observing the capabilities actually exposed by the current host
It selects exactly one execution path:
full-autopilot
real side jobs + sandbox/tools when observed
tool-rich-sequential
sandbox/tools + sequential role contracts
safe-skill-only
bounded planning/critique only, with HOLD when execution is required
Unknown capabilities are treated as unavailable. The plugin never claims a subagent, tool call, render, file, connected-app action, or publication action that did not actually happen
Evidence finishes first. After the evidence boundary is finalized, real delegation can fan out creative-direction exploration, visual-archetype exploration, and copy-compression critique in parallel. Dependency-bound production then proceeds through explicit gates
When sandbox writes are available, the workflow persists logical artifacts for evidence, concepts, copy, layout, build, still review, motion, render QA, verifier output, and final delivery. This reduces context loss and lets later QA inspect the same production inputs
Workspace Agents are optional external execution capabilities. Installing the skills-only plugin does not automatically register them
OpenAI visual discipline
The OpenAI package does not collapse concept, layout, motion, and QA into one pass
Its production flow is:
capability negotiation
-> evidence research and finalized evidence boundary
-> parallel creative side jobs when real delegation exists
-> creative directions
-> story architecture
-> copy compression
-> macro layout
-> still construction
-> complete still taxonomy + targeted repair
-> motion direction only after still PASS
-> motion implementation
-> render QA
-> independent final verification
The still gate is blocking before motion
It explicitly rejects top-heavy compositions, unexplained bottom dead zones, detached footers, weak visual anchors, nested-card density, generic UI grammar, weak macro rhythm, feed-scale legibility failures, motion on weak stills, and decorative motion
The full Autopilot visual contract also keeps the 1080×1350 default canvas, roughly 82-92% usable vertical occupancy target, greater-than-120px unexplained footer-gap rejection, maximum two bordered containment levels, and explicit PASS/FAIL taxonomy from the studio quality floor

What it makes
A strong output should have
| Part | Standard |
|---|---|
| Hook | One opening idea worth stopping for |
| Visual idea | One dominant concept readable at feed size |
| WOW | A fresh visual or motion move that serves the story |
| AHA | A payoff that changes understanding |
| Story | A clear shape such as comparison, process, transformation, proof, interface flow, or framework |
| Color | Creative and attractive without becoming loud |
| Composition | Intentional macro rhythm with no unexplained dead space |
| Motion | Deliberate, deterministic, and tied to meaning |
| Evidence | Claims, metrics, product states, logos, and proof tied to supplied material |
| Finish | Still QA, mechanical QA, critique, and independent verification |
Creative runtime
Before story architecture starts, Claude's creative-director creates at least three genuinely different directions in build/creative-concepts.json
The OpenAI autopilot applies the same creative standard. Evidence is finalized first. With real delegation observed, the creative-direction, visual-archetype, and copy-compression discovery jobs can then run in parallel. Without delegation, the same contracts run sequentially without pretending agents were spawned
Each direction defines a visual hook, copy hook, aha mechanic, story shape, visual archetype, motion behavior, evidence dependencies, risks, and why the idea deserves attention
At least one direction must contain a real visual payoff, not a palette swap or a new card arrangement
Info-stories
Info-stories separates four decisions:
- Story House for visual character and palette
- Visual Style for composition grammar
- Story Archetype for information structure
- Motion Pattern for how attention moves
The canonical Claude/repository source of truth is the merged registry returned by scripts/info_stories.py::load_catalog()
The OpenAI public package carries the execution rules it needs inside openai-skills/ instead of depending on unavailable repository worker registration
UI Mockup Stories are first-class options. Real-looking product behavior must be supported by evidence. Concept UI stays clearly identifiable when it could be mistaken for real product proof
Exact-SVG mascots
If the user asks for a named or official mascot, the plugin uses the exact SVG supplied by the user or attached to the task
No silent redraw
No substitute
No lookalike
The Claude mascot path inspects the supplied SVG, finds usable geometry, develops motion around the real asset, preserves identity, and checks the animated result against the untouched source

Visual defaults
- Palette character:
creative-attractive-restrained - Text contrast:
4.5:1minimum - State contrast:
3:1minimum - One dominant visual anchor at feed scale
- Macro zones before component styling
- Motion intensity comes from the story, not from a need to animate everything
The OpenAI visual contract additionally targets roughly 82-92% usable vertical occupancy, rejects unexplained gaps greater than 120px near the footer, and limits bordered containment depth to two levels
